Output 86a827c84ce1a30174660d4793db01f004807c53e52b486a1a0606ba8fd58786:0

value
20370640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35e703702bc20d2fbcc7aee10adfec9cf29155e2 OP_EQUAL
address
9wMHDejBauACwU79zTHqY5Rge73Zh1BdLk
transaction
86a827c84ce1a30174660d4793db01f004807c53e52b486a1a0606ba8fd58786